Psoralea General Information Psoralea is a climbing bean found all throughout China. Psoralea seeds are pungent and bitter. This plant is one of the main herbs in traditional Chinese and Japanese herbal medicine for the treatment of skin conditions. Bu Gu Zhi,
Choosing a selection results in a full page refresh.
Press the space key then arrow keys to make a selection.